Précédent   Forum des professionnels en informatique > Logiciels > Microsoft Office > Access > VBA Access
VBA Access Le forum pour les questions relatives au code VBA sous Access, et à son environnement de développement VBE.
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 23/12/2010, 15h45   #1
Invité de passage
 
Sylvain
Inscription : décembre 2010
Messages : 1
Détails du profil
Informations personnelles :
Nom : Sylvain

Informations forums :
Inscription : décembre 2010
Messages : 1
Points : 0
Points : 0
Par défaut Diverses alertes à échéances Date + x années et avertis en Date -x jours

Bonjours à tous,

Voilà n'étant pas expert en la matière, je dois faire un formulaire contenant diverses informations sur les salariés.

Mon soucis est le suivant, j'ai certains champs indiquant les dates d'obtention des divers permis, et j'aimerais avoir une alerte MsgBox ainsi qu'un courriel de rappel en Date +5 ans et Date_échéance -x jours car certains permis doivent être renouvelés tous les 5 ans; et tout en prévoyant que l'alerte se basera à partir de la dernière date de renouvellement.

Cette date de renouvellement pourrait-elle être auto-incrémentable après validation ?

Et la même chose pour les visites médicales qui elles, sont tous les ans.

Plus clairement, pour les permis j'ai des Zone de texte pour :
A) Année d'obtention du permis
B) Année de renouvellement du permis
C) Rappel de renouvellement
D) Alarme en jours pour le N-x jours
E ) Pour les texte personnalisé du MsgBox et du Courriel

Pour la visite médicale j'ai une seule zone de texte qui devra m'alerter tous les ans à date anniversaire.

Dernière question : Avec toutes les données puis-je faire en sorte d'imprimer un format A6 R°/V° avec certaines informations de ma base pour en faire des cartes d'habilitation pour l'entreprise.

D'avance je vous remercie à tous, pour l'aide que vous pourriez m'apporter.
Fichiers attachés
Type de fichier : zip personnel STTP.zip (144,3 Ko, 7 affichages)
ShadesSTTP est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 23/12/2010, 17h14   #2
Modérateur
 
Homme René MAROT
Inscription : octobre 2005
Messages : 5 458
Détails du profil
Informations personnelles :
Nom : Homme René MAROT
Localisation : Canada

Informations forums :
Inscription : octobre 2005
Messages : 5 458
Points : 7 534
Points : 7 534
Citation:
Envoyé par ShadesSTTP Voir le message
Bonjours à tous,
Mon soucis est le suivant, j'ai certains champs indiquant les dates d'obtention des divers permis, et j'aimerais avoir une alerte MsgBox ainsi qu'un courriel de rappel en Date +5 ans et Date_échéance -x jours car certains permis doivent être renouvelés tous les 5 ans; et tout en prévoyant que l'alerte se basera à partir de la dernière date de renouvellement.
Grace à la fonction DateAdd() tu peux ajouter des jours ou des années à uen date. Il faudra tout de même vérfier qu'elle donne bien les résultats attendus.

DateRenouvellementCalculee=DateAdd("y", PeriodeRenouvellement, DateRenouvellement)
DateRenouvellementAlerte=DateAdd("d", PeriodeAlerte, DateRenouvellementCalculee)

Note PeriodeAlerte doit être négatif

Citation:
Cette date de renouvellement pourrait-elle être auto-incrémentable après validation ?
Il suffit de faire un bouton Validation qui va faire quelque chose du genre :

Code :
Me.DateRenouvellement=dateRouvellementCalculee
Citation:
Et la même chose pour les visites médicales qui elles, sont tous les ans.
Idem pour les date de visites médicales que je te suggère de gérer comme un permis renouvelé à chaque année.

Citation:
Plus clairement, pour les permis j'ai des Zone de texte pour :
A) Année d'obtention du permis
B) Année de renouvellement du permis
C) Rappel de renouvellement
D) Alarme en jours pour le N-x jours
E ) Pour les texte personnalisé du MsgBox et du Courriel

Pour la visite médicale j'ai une seule zone de texte qui devra m'alerter tous les ans à date anniversaire.
Citation:
Dernière question : Avec toutes les données puis-je faire en sorte d'imprimer un format A6 R°/V° avec certaines informations de ma base pour en faire des cartes d'habilitation pour l'entreprise.
C'est quoi A6 comme dimension. A priori si ton imprmante accepte ce format tu devrais pouvoir.

A+
__________________
Vous voulez une réponse rapide et efficace à vos questions téchniques ? Ne les posez pas en message privé mais dans le forum, vous bénéficiez ainsi de la compétence et de la disponibilité de tous les contributeurs.
marot_r est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 10h49.


 
 
 
 
Partenaires

Hébergement Web